What episode is "Girl of Steel" in Jujutsu Kaisen?
"Girl of Steel" is episode 3 of Jujutsu Kaisen.
Yuji, Megumi, and a new classmate face their first field test battling curses, uncovering personal motivations and forming bonds as they prepare for the challenges ahead.
Yuji, Megumi and Satoru pick up the third first-year student Nobara Kugisaki. Satoru brings them to an abandoned building near a cemetery that is occupied by Curses as a field test for Nobara. Yuji and Nobara enter the building and split up to search for the Curse. Yuji easily defeats a Curse downstairs while Nobara takes out another one upstairs, and discovers a boy hiding. Another Curse holds him hostage, and Nobara surrenders in an attempt to save him. Yuji is able to rescue Nobara and the boy by smashing through the wall behind it and cutting one of its arms off. As the Curse attempts to flee, Nobara finishes it off with her Straw Doll technique. A flashback reveals Nobara had a friend named Saori who was ostracized by the locals because she was from Tokyo before being driven away, convincing Nobara to enroll in the Tokyo Metropolitan Magic Technical College and move away from her town. As a reward for completing the test, Satoru takes them out to dinner. A month later, three sorcerers are dispatched to exorcise a Cursed Womb at a detention center in West Tokyo, leaving one dead.
